Cult of Love focuses on the Dahl Family and their calamitous holiday season. The four adult children return to their childhood home with partners in tow. The Dahl traditions include singing carols in harmony at the drop of a hat, but the gathering is anything but harmonious. Old conflicts resurface, new issues battled, and dinner is taking absolutely forever to be served.
Leslye Heartland returns to Second Stage which produced her play, Bachelorette, in its Uptown Series, and her play, The Layover, off-Broadway at the Kiser Theater. She recently completed “Star Wars: The Acolyte” for the Disney+ streaming platform. She served as writer, director, executive producer, and showrunner. Headland served as writer, producing director and showrunner for Netflix’s acclaimed series “Russian Doll.” The series was nominated for three Primetime Emmy Awards. Drama League nominee Trip Cullman (I Can Get It For You Wholesale) directs.
